🔍 Product Overview

The EOLITE LASERS MOPA-NS MO Board is a critical control module designed for precision management of MOPA laser systems. Featuring advanced electronics and robust power regulation, this board controls the laser’s master oscillator and power amplifier sections, ensuring stable and accurate output.

⚙️ Its microprocessor-based architecture supports real-time modulation of laser pulses, vital for applications requiring high precision such as laser marking, engraving, and micro-welding. The PCBA revision 226317 introduces improved signal filtering and enhanced thermal performance to increase reliability in demanding industrial environments.

🔧 Designed for compatibility with EOLITE’s MOPA laser units, this PCB offers easy integration and modularity, reducing downtime and simplifying maintenance.


📰 Industrial News: Laser Technology Advances in Manufacturing

The laser processing industry continues to grow rapidly, driven by demand for higher precision, speed, and flexibility in manufacturing. In 2025, MOPA laser systems have gained traction for their ability to generate customizable pulse widths and frequencies, enabling refined material processing and reduced thermal impact.

Manufacturers in automotive, electronics, and medical device sectors are increasingly adopting laser modules powered by advanced control boards like EOLITE’s MOPA-NS MO Board. This trend reflects the broader shift toward smart manufacturing and Industry 4.0, where laser solutions contribute to automation and product quality improvement.
